The Event Planning Agreement Template for Business in Florida is a detailed legal document that outlines the terms of employment between a Manager and an Association for the purpose of managing events and expositions. It specifies the Manager's duties, compensation structure, including salary and a share of net profits from the events, as well as conditions for employment renewal and termination. Key features include clearly defined responsibilities of the Manager, methods for calculating net profits, reimbursement of business expenses, and an obligation to maintain accurate financial records. The template also addresses compliance with the Association's policies and mandates annual reporting. How to Write a Business Contract Step 1 – Determine Why You Need a Contract. Step 2 – Define All Relevant Parties. Step 3 – Include the Essential Elements of a Contract. Step 4 – Name the Appropriate Governing Law and Jurisdiction. Step 5 – Explain All Details in Plain Language. Step 6 – Use Repeatable Language.
